Communication is Key:

Open and honest communication is the cornerstone of any healthy relationship, especially in a long-distance scenario. Regular communication helps partners feel connected and involved in each other's lives. Technology has made it easier than ever to stay in touch through text messages, phone calls, video chats, and social media. Set aside dedicated time to catch up and share your thoughts and feelings with your partner.

Setting Boundaries:

Establishing clear boundaries is essential in long-distance relationships to build trust and avoid misunderstandings. Discuss with your partner what is acceptable and what is not in terms of communication, interactions with others, and personal space. These boundaries will help maintain respect and trust between both partners.

Fostering Emotional Connection:

Emotional connection is vital for maintaining intimacy and trust in a long-distance relationship. Find ways to emotionally connect with your partner, such as sharing your dreams and aspirations, discussing your fears and insecurities, and supporting each other through challenges. Plan virtual dates, send surprise gifts, and engage in activities that strengthen your emotional bond.

Building Trust Over Time:

Trust in a long-distance relationship is built gradually over time through consistent communication and actions. Be reliable and consistent in your interactions with your partner, and follow through on your promises. Trust your partner and give them the benefit of the doubt when misunderstandings arise. Demonstrating trustworthiness and integrity will strengthen the foundation of your relationship.
